Choosing the Right Social Media Platform

Not all social media platforms are created equal when it comes to announcing grad school acceptance. Here are some popular options:

  • Facebook: Facebook is a great platform to share your news with friends and family. You can create a post with a photo or video, and add a link to your acceptance email or letter.
  • Twitter: Twitter is ideal for short updates and updates. You can share a tweet with a photo or video, and use relevant hashtags to reach a wider audience.
  • Instagram: Instagram is a great platform to share a photo or video of yourself. You can use Instagram Stories or IGTV to share a longer update.
  • LinkedIn: LinkedIn is a professional platform where you can share your news with colleagues and industry connections.

Tips and Tricks

Here are some additional tips and tricks to help you announce your grad school acceptance on social media:

  • Use relevant hashtags: Use relevant hashtags to reach a wider audience. For example, #GradSchoolAcceptance, #GradSchoolLife, #AcademicAchievement.
  • Tag relevant people: Tag relevant people in your announcement post, such as friends, family, and colleagues.
  • Use emojis: Use emojis to add a touch of personality to your announcement post.
  • Keep it concise: Keep your announcement post concise and to the point. Avoid using jargon or technical terms that may confuse your audience.
  • Be authentic: Be authentic and genuine in your announcement post. Share your excitement and gratitude, and don’t be afraid to show your personality.
